When embarking on DIY projects, having the right hand tools is crucial. Essential tools can transform a simple idea into a reality. A reliable hammer is a must-have. It helps drive nails effectively and can also remove them. Consider a lightweight option for less strain during longer projects.

Another critical tool is a tape measure. An accurate tape measure ensures precision. Measure twice to avoid costly mistakes. Investing in a sturdy level can help align your project correctly. Leveling prevents future structural problems, saving time and effort later on.

Power Tools That Enhance Efficiency and Precision

When diving into DIY projects, having the right tools can make all the difference. Power tools are essential for enhancing efficiency and precision. A cordless drill, for example, allows you to work in tight spaces without being tethered to an outlet. It's perfect for assembling furniture or drilling holes quickly. Ensure you have a good selection of drill bits for various materials to maximize its utility.

A power saw can transform your projects dramatically. Whether you're cutting wood for a shelf or crafting intricate designs, the right saw makes clean cuts every time. Invest in both a jigsaw for curves and a circular saw for straight lines. Remember, practice makes perfect. Start with scrap wood to refine your technique before working on your final pieces.

Safety Gear Every DIY Enthusiast Should Wear

When diving into DIY projects, safety gear is crucial. Safety glasses protect your eyes from flying debris and dust. A sturdy pair of gloves shields your hands from sharp edges and rough materials. Often overlooked, a dust mask can help you avoid inhaling harmful particles. These simple items significantly reduce risks.

Wearing the right attire is also part of safety. Long sleeves keep your skin covered while working with tools. Closed-toe shoes offer protection from heavy objects. Must-Have Organizational Supplies for DIY Spaces

Creating an organized DIY space is key to any successful project. Start by investing in storage solutions that suit your needs. Clear bins are useful for sorting tools and materials by category. Label each bin clearly, so you can find things quickly. This system reduces frustration when you're in the middle of a project.

Shelving units can help maximize vertical space. They provide easy access to often-used items. Consider pegboards for hanging tools. They keep your workspace tidy and visible. You can quickly see what you have and what you might need.
